The main differences between references and pointers are -

  • References are used to refer an existing variable in another name whereas pointers are used to store the address of a variable.
  • References cannot have a null value assigned but pointer can.
  • A reference variable can be referenced bypass by value whereas a pointer can be referenced but pass by reference
  • A reference must be initialized on declaration while it is not necessary in case of a pointer.
  • A reference shares the same memory address with the original variable but also takes up some space on the stack whereas a pointer has its own memory address and size on the stack.
